The Parallel Sensorless Pump Controller is an add-on control device that coordinates the output of multiple pumping units in a parallel configuration to achieve significant energy savings. Featuring advanced sensorless technology, the pump controller controls up to four of the manufacturer’s Design Envelope pumping units and delivers energy efficiency, along with reduced installation costs. The monitoring and instruction provided by a parallel sensorless pump controller can coordinate operations to achieve even greater energy savings. According to the manufacturer, when used in combination with its Design Envelope pumps, the Parallel Sensorless Pump Controller can help building owners significantly reduce their energy costs and achieve much greater efficiency throughout the system’s life cycle.

62 Buckingham Gate is a cutting edge, environmentally-sensitive Land Securities development in the Victoria area of London, on the site of the now demolished Selbourne House, SW1. Designed for mixed use, the scheme will provide 252,000 sq ft of premium office space, together with street level access shops and restaurants.

The 13-storey development, which occupies a prime position at the junction of Victoria Street and Buckingham Gate, has been designed to provide a highly flexible office environment, with large amounts of open-plan, column free space. A canopied pedestrian area has been incorporated to connect the surrounding streetscape and provide space for pavement cafés and outdoor public seating.

The Eco*Pulse™ HVAC Health Management Service combines diagnostic technology with expert review to help keep central cooling systems operating at optimal performance. It is offered as a subscription-based service with Armstrong’s Integrated Plant Controller and OptiVisor™ products. The service provides building owners and operators with timely and concise insight and recommendations to keep their cooling system running at an optimal level. Key aspects of the service include daily notifications that summarize performance; pinpoint possible issues and provide recommended remedies; and an intuitive Web interface for summary, regular review, and quarterly reports that dwell on the ongoing nuances of the customer’s central cooling system.

Armstrong Fluid Technology has introduced a new circulator featuring industry-leading Design Envelope technology. The new COMPASS circulator helps contractors and wholesalers with easy selection, fast installation and extremely broad performance capabilities for application to a wide variety of installations.

The new COMPASS circulator also helps homeowners reduce energy consumption and operating costs. In “Auto” mode, (one of 8 operating modes available for selection) the COMPASS circulator adjusts operating speed to match HVAC demand at any given moment. Over time, the COMPASS circulator also learns a system’s patterns of demand and appropriately adjusts output to reduce energy usage even more.

Armstrong Fluid Technology has launched an automated control solution designed to drive additional energy savings from chiller plant.

Interfacing seamlessly with the existing building automation system, the Armstrong Opti-Visor controls the key energy-using components of the chiller plant, providing the optimal operating settings for equipment such as water-cooled, variable-flow chillers, compressors, cooling towers and condenser water pumps.
